SUMMARY: The Food and Drug Administration (FDA) is announcing the 
availability of a draft guidance for industry entitled ``Civil Money 
Penalties for Tobacco Retailers: Responses to Frequently Asked 
Questions.'' This draft guidance provides responses to questions FDA 
has received regarding the issuance of civil money penalties for 
violations of regulations issued under the Federal Food, Drug, and 
Cosmetic Act (FD&C Act) relating to tobacco products in retail outlets. 
This draft guidance is not final nor is it in effect at this time.

I. Background

    This draft guidance provides responses to questions FDA has 
received regarding the issuance of civil money penalties for violations 
of regulations issued under the FD&C Act relating to tobacco products 
in retail outlets. In this draft guidance, FDA provides responses to 
questions relating to civil money penalties for violations of the 
requirement that tobacco products may not be sold or distributed in 
violation of FDA's ``Regulations Restricting the Sale and Distribution 
of Cigarettes and Smokeless Tobacco to Protect Children and 
Adolescents'' (75 FR 13225, March 19, 2010, codified at 21 CFR part 
1140). This draft guidance also provides additional information 
regarding the complaint procedure used for civil money penalties.

II. Significance of Guidance

    This draft guidance is being issued consistent with FDA's good 
guidance practices regulation (21 CFR 10.115). The draft guidance, when 
finalized, will represent the Agency's current thinking on ``Civil 
Money Penalties for Tobacco Retailers: Responses to Frequently Asked 
Questions.'' It does not create or confer any rights for or on any 
person and does not operate to bind FDA or the public. An alternative 
approach may be used if such approach satisfies the requirements of the 
applicable statute and regulations.
